Output cc90e6f3e8f0d891936d17bb72b85ca31829f1b280fcecb001727c9037593916:97

value
169774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ff1c531d5994887121bc88e6b2cba21672c205 OP_EQUAL
address
39oazph4NW2pYnmXrePGzNGvmrHQLuRbLk
transaction
cc90e6f3e8f0d891936d17bb72b85ca31829f1b280fcecb001727c9037593916